One my 9 month hybrids has stopped laying for 3 weeks now but also is molting on her neck and tail? Is this normal? Thought they had to be over a year old? Could it be a mini molt?

Yep, it can happen.
Some pullets will have a partial molt at about that age their first fall/winter.
Full adult molt won't happen until about 14-18 months their second fall/winter.

Yes, I've even had birds younger then that molt. Like between 4-5 months old is the most common I see.
All chickens have a several juvenile molts between hatch and about 6 months.
